What is ABA therapy and how can it support children in Woodstock Hill?
ABA (Applied Behavior Analysis) therapy is an evidence-based approach that helps children with autism build communication, social, and daily living skills through structured, positive reinforcement. In Woodstock Hill, ABA therapy is often delivered in familiar environments like the home, school settings, or community spaces so children can practice skills where they naturally use them.

Insurance & ABA Therapy Support in Woodstock Hill
Understanding ABA therapy insurance does not have to be overwhelming. ABA Journey works with Anthem Blue Cross Blue Shield, Georgia Medicaid, Peachstate, Ambetter, CareSource, and Amerigroup to help families in Woodstock Hill and the surrounding Woodstock area access ABA services with clarity and confidence.
Our insurance coordination team can assist with benefit verification, prior authorization, and claims support, so you can focus on your child’s care instead of paperwork.
